Troubleshooting

If you have difficulty with your thermostat, please try the following.
Most problems can be corrected quickly and easily.
Display is blank
No response to
key presses (or
temperature
does not
change)
Backlight is dim
• Check circuit breaker and reset if necessary.
• Make sure power switch at heating & cooling system is ON.
• Make sure furnace door is closed securely.
• Check to make sure the thermostat is not locked (see page 18).
• Make sure heating and cooling temperatures are set to acceptable
ranges:
• Heat: 40° to 90°F (4.5° to 32°C)
• Cool: 50° to 99°F (10° to 37°C)
• If thermostat is AC powered, a dim display is normal. The backlight
remains ON at a low level, and brightens when a key is pressed.
